2001 Mazda Demio vs. 2007 Volvo C70

To start off, 2007 Volvo C70 is newer by 6 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2001 Mazda Demio.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2001 Mazda Demio would be higher. At 2,521 cc (5 cylinders), 2007 Volvo C70 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2007 Volvo C70 (218 HP @ 5000 RPM) has 156 more horse power than 2001 Mazda Demio. (62 HP @ 5000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2007 Volvo C70 should accelerate faster than 2001 Mazda Demio.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2007 Volvo C70 weights approximately 701 kg more than 2001 Mazda Demio.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2007 Volvo C70 (320 Nm @ 1500 RPM) has 219 more torque (in Nm) than 2001 Mazda Demio. (101 Nm @ 3000 RPM). This means 2007 Volvo C70 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2001 Mazda Demio.
